What is watching on trello?
Watching allows you to be notified when another user makes a change to a card, list or board in Trello. When watching a card, you’ll get notifications for… All comments. Adding, changing, and upcoming due dates.
Is trello data safe?
Trello is ISO/IEC 27001 certified which validates our information security management system (ISMS) and the implementation of our security controls. More information is available on the Atlassian Trust Management System. Trello is PCI-DSS certified.

Is trello free private?
Public Data vs Private Data in Trello
You have full control over the visibility of your data, and all defaults favor privacy. You have the ability to make boards and teams private, in which case only added members will be able to view the board or team.
How does trello make money?
Trello makes money by charging private or enterprise consumers a monthly subscription fee. … Apart from its free plans, the company offers three monthly subscription options. These are called Trello Gold, Trello Business Class and Trello Enterprise.

Is trello owned by Google?
Trello is a web-based Kanban-style list-making application which is a subsidiary of Atlassian. Originally created by Fog Creek Software in 2011, it was spun out to form the basis of a separate company in 2014 and later sold to Atlassian in January 2017.
